Committee investigating Capitol robbery recommends that Steve Bannon face criminal contempt charges

2021-10-20T01:04:56.577Z


The top White House strategist under Trump and the former president's top adviser has refused to cooperate with the investigation, so the House of Representatives will vote to refer him to the Justice Department. Bannon could face up to a year in prison and a $ 100,000 fine.

The Select Committee of the House of Representatives investigating the assault on the Capitol on January 6 voted in favor on Tuesday of presenting a motion to ask the Department of Justice that the former top adviser to Donald Trump, Steve Bannon, be charged with criminal contempt. to Congress after he refused to cooperate with the investigation.

The committee, made up of seven Democrats and two Republicans, approved the measure with nine votes in favor and none against, so it will be sent to the plenary session of the Lower House for a final vote.

If approved by the House of Representatives, lawmakers will report to the federal attorney for the District of Columbia, who will decide whether or not to press charges against Bannon.

If charged and convicted,

Trump's former adviser would face up to a year in jail and could be fined $ 100,000

.

The committee chairman, Rep. Bennie Thompson, D-Missouri, called Bannon's refusal to cooperate "impressive."

"So it's a shame that Bannon has put us in this situation. But we are not going to take 'no' for an answer. We believe that Mr. Bannon has information relevant to our investigation and we will use the tools at our disposal to obtain that information. I hope the House of Representatives will expeditiously approve his referral to the Justice Department and that the US Attorney for the District of Columbia will do his job and prosecute Bannon for criminal contempt of Congress, "Thompson said.

He added: "Our goal is simple: we want Mr. Bannon to answer our questions. We want him to turn over all the recordings in his possession that are relevant to the Select Committee's investigation. The question before us today is the ability to do our work".
